I was looking at several homes in southern phoenix and wondered if they are too good to be true. I read that south of Baseline Rd is good. All homes I have looked at are a little north of W Basline, south of W Southern Ave and east of S 27th Ave. I really like their location to shopping, churches, etc. I have no children so I'm not concerned with schools. And I work from home, so commuting is not an issue. The homes are in and around "Lantana Estates". Is this a safe area? Any help would be greatly appreciated.

If you moved east a few streets, to 19A/Southern, you would be in the epicenter of the 'South Phoenix Hood' and Lindo Park neighborhood.

The only area that I would consider worse would be 24st/Broadway.

Probably too good to be true

south of baseline and preferably south of dobbins between 19th ave and 27th ave are safe.. many multi-million dollar homes on acreage lots that back onto the mountain, great views of the city as well.

There are lots of new developments in the 85041 zip. I have lived in this zip for more than ten years and like the area. Check out the 85339 zip, too. The whole area is finally starting to grow and attract younger families. In some of the older neighborhoods you will find horse properties. It is just a short ride by horseback to South Mounatain Park, which is not only used by horse owners for riding, but there is also a lot biking and hiking.
